this isn't a defence but surprisingly few people know how many units of alcohol it takes to be over the 50mg drink drive limit. for some that can be the equivalent of 1 pint of beer (175ml glass of wine as well). if as reported he was 3 times that it would be 3 pints of beer. if the driver is on cocktails then the alcohol content in these depend on the drink and on the bar they are made in.
It also takes an hour for each unit to be processed by your body so 10 pints on day of game by a supporter and then driving the next morning (even mid-morning) could still put you over limit.
so the only way to be sure is to not drink at all and drive. as I say not a defence but just showing how easy it is to err and still feel okay to drive.
